12 months agoDon't see .story files for old courses...
A client has just asked for the source files for a course that's 5+ years old. I look at what I have in my source files folder but don't see any .story files, just .ppta and .quiz. Is that because the files were created so long ago?? And, yes, I've already tried looking here....%appdata%\Articulate\Storyline

If you see .ppta and .quiz it's possible the course was built with Articulate Studio and not Storyline since those are files associated with it.

When I open the ppta files I just see, basically, Powerpoints. But the courses we're trying to resurrect were not linear like that. Any way to get them into Storyline?
- As noted before, the PPTA/Quiz files are for Studio. Do you have access to a published version of the client file? You should be able to tell if it was created in Studio or Storyline.
- Assuming the source files match the course (and you have them all) you can import the files into Storyline. This article explains what you need to do if you have .ppta.
